GNU/Linux >> LINUX-Kenntnisse >  >> Linux

Plasma-Desktop kstart:Verbindung zum X-Server nicht möglich - Was nun?

Hier ist ein interessantes kleines Problem. Ich benutzte fröhlich meinen Plasma-Desktop, als er plötzlich kaputt ging. Aber auf eine schlechte Art und Weise kaputt, nicht auf eine gute Art und Weise. Dies bedeutet, dass alle Fensterdekorationen verschwunden sind und nichts wirklich auf Mausklicks reagiert. Und hier kommt der Rätselzug, nonstop nach Foobar. Ich wollte die Plasma-Shell neu starten und einfach weiterarbeiten - schließlich habe ich diesen Workaround in der Vergangenheit ein paar Mal erwähnt, wie in meinen Slimbook- und Kubuntu-Kampfberichten. In der Tat. Außer ...

Das hat nicht funktioniert. In der virtuellen Konsole (das einzige, was tatsächlich funktionierte) hatte ich den Fehler kstart:Verbindung zum X-Server kann nicht hergestellt werden. An diesem Punkt war ein Neustart oder Magie erforderlich, und ich wollte wirklich einen Neustart vermeiden müssen. Im Allgemeinen ist ein Neustart eine faule Art, Probleme zu beheben, und sollte sparsam durchgeführt werden. Lassen Sie uns also über einen besseren, weniger destruktiven Weg sprechen.

Du musst dabei sein, um es zu verstehen

Aha. Das ist das Wortspiel des Jahrhunderts. Und danke an einige kluge KDE-Leute, die zufällig neben mir saßen, während ich leise in der Ecke weinte. Die Sache ist, dass der KWin-Fenstermanager manchmal verwirrt wird oder stirbt, und wir müssen ihn wieder zum Leben erwecken. Machen wir das auf eine nette, saubere Art und Weise. Öffnen Sie eine virtuelle Konsole - Strg + Alt + F1-7 (mit Ausnahme derjenigen, die Sie gerade mit einem geborstenen Desktop verwenden) und melden Sie sich dort mit Ihren Anmeldeinformationen an.

export DISPLAY=:0
kwin_x11

Als nächstes exportieren Sie die Anzeige und starten den Prozess kwin_x11. Dies sollte Ihnen die Kontrolle über Ihren Desktop zurückgeben. Kehren Sie mit der Desktop-Sitzung zu Ihrer virtuellen Konsole zurück und starten Sie KRunner (ein äußerst nützliches, integriertes Startprogramm für Plasma-Desktop-Mehrzweckanwendungen).


Geben Sie im Befehlsfenster Folgendes ein:

kwin_x11 --ersetzen

Dadurch wird die Window-Manager-Sitzung, die in einer der anderen virtuellen Konsolen ausgeführt wird, durch eine neue ersetzt. Dann können wir endlich die Plasma-Shell starten und zurück zum Leben in la vida loca sein:

Plasmaschale

Problem gelöst. Plasma-Desktop läuft. Keine Neustarts. Arbeit erledigt.

Schlussfolgerung

Das war kurz, aber süß. Zumal wir unsere Desktop-Sitzung nicht zerstören mussten, und das ist immer ein Bonus. Ich bin froh, dass der Plasma-Desktop widerstandsfähig genug ist, um Abstürze des Window-Managers zu überstehen, und dieses Tutorial zeigt, wie man das bewerkstelligt, ohne dass zusätzliche Tränen vergossen werden. Ich würde sogar vorschlagen, dass Sie die notwendigen Schritte und Befehle in eine Textdatei oder ein Skript schreiben, damit Sie sie bei Bedarf verwenden können, insbesondere wenn Sie kein anderes System haben, mit dem Sie nach Online-Informationen suchen könnten .

Mit all den Daten und Optimierungen, die ich in meinen Slimbook- und Kubuntu-Berichten niedergelegt habe, sowie den verschiedenen Plasma-Secrets-Artikeln, schätze ich, dass Sie so ziemlich alles haben, was Sie brauchen, um eine lebendige Desktop-Sitzung über Tage und Wochen am Ende und sogar am Laufen zu halten Wenn ab und zu etwas schief geht, müssen Sie nicht neu starten und Ihre Arbeit verlieren. Na siehst du. Wir sind hier fertig. Plasmae weiter.


Linux
  1. So verbinden Sie ONLYOFFICE Desktop Editors v.6.3 mit Ihrem Seafile-Server

  2. Ubuntu Server vs. Desktop:Was ist der Unterschied?

  3. Fehlerhaft, fehlende Abhängigkeiten, was nun?

  4. Verbinden Sie sich mit einem Cloud-Server

  5. OpenConnect kann keine Verbindung zum VPN-Server herstellen:Wait.html wird für immer aktualisiert

Einige nette Widgets für Ihren Plasma-Desktop

Wie man den Plasma-Desktop wie Unity aussehen lässt

Wie man den Plasma-Desktop wie einen Mac aussehen lässt

Linux-VPN-Plug-in-Fehler – Was nun?

Remotedesktop-Fehlerbehebung

Was ist neu in KDE Plasma 5.25